Logo
Cisco Systems, Inc.

Technical Lead, Software Engineer - AI Assistant

Cisco Systems, Inc., Milpitas, California, United States, 95035

Save Job

Technical Lead, Software Engineer - AI Assistant Location: Milpitas, California, US

Alternate Location: Seattle, Washington

Area of Interest: Engineer - Software

Compensation Range: 210600 USD - 305100 USD

Job Type: Professional

Technology Interest: AI or Artificial Intelligence

Job Id: 1451396

What You Will Do

Architect and lead technical integration of major Cisco product lines (e.g., Webex, Meraki, ThousandEyes, AppDynamics) by integrating frameworks for seamless deployment of AI agents across Cisco’s network, collaboration, and observability domains.

Develop APIs, SDKs, and microservices enabling data, model, and workflow interoperability between Canvas and Cisco products.

Lead end-to-end development of the AI Canvas Developer Portal—a self-service hub for developers to access APIs, SDKs, documentation, sample apps, and sandboxes.

Integrate telemetry, analytics, and feedback loops to measure developer engagement and continuously improve the experience.

Drive technical strategy and roadmap for Cisco + Canvas integrations aligned with Cisco’s AI-first strategy.

Design and build effective interfaces between AI services, ensuring smooth communication and data exchange while adhering to security and performance requirements.

Collaborate with UX designers and analyze user feedback to identify frictional workflows, then build tools to streamline those processes.

Collaborate with LLM engineers to optimize prompt-tool interactions.

Serve as a senior architect and mentor for cross-functional engineering teams.

Basic Qualifications

10+ years in software engineering, systems architecture, or platform development.

3+ years of experience in software engineering, with recent exposure to AI assistants.

Expertise in building scalable, production-grade AI services leveraging public cloud infrastructure, containerization (Kubernetes, Docker), and CI/CD pipelines.

Hands-on experience creating enterprise Generative AI solutions using prompt engineering, LLM fine-tuning, and orchestration tools (e.g., LangChain, LlamaIndex, Semantic Kernel, AutoGen) integrated in public cloud ecosystems.

Hands-on experience with NLP techniques including text classification, sentiment analysis, NLG, and working with large language models.

Familiarity with AI/ML pipelines, MLOps, or AI infrastructure platforms (e.g., Vertex AI, OpenAI, AWS Sagemaker).

Hands-on experience with Python, Go, TypeScript, React and API frameworks (GraphQL, REST).

Deep understanding of developer experience principles and portal/platform architecture.

Excellent communication and leadership skills, with the ability to influence cross-functional stakeholders.

Preferred Qualifications

Experience in security focused SaaS providers.

Prior experience building developer portals or marketplaces.

Familiarity with AI governance or compliance in enterprise settings.

The capacity to think critically and tackle complex, innovative problems in the field.

A willingness to continuously learn and adapt, crucial in the ever-evolving field of AI.

Background in leading open-source or internal developer tooling initiatives.

Why Cisco? #WeAreCisco

Where every individual brings their unique skills and perspectives together to pursue our purpose of powering an inclusive future for all.

We celebrate our employees' diverse backgrounds and focus on unlocking potential. Cisco supports learning, development, and hybrid work trends. Our culture includes inclusive communities and volunteering time off to give back.

Our purpose is to be the worldwide leader in technology that powers the internet, helping customers reimagine their applications, secure their enterprise, transform their infrastructure, and meet sustainability goals.

#CiscoAIJobs

Message to applicants applying to work in the U.S. and/or Canada When available, the salary range posted for this position reflects the projected hiring range for new hires, full-time salaries in U.S. and/or Canada locations, not including equity or benefits. For non-sales roles the hiring ranges reflect base salary only; employees are also eligible to receive annual bonuses. Hiring ranges for sales positions include base and incentive compensation target. Individual pay is determined by location and other factors.

U.S. employees have access to medical, dental, and vision insurance, a 401(k) plan with Cisco matching, disability coverage, basic life insurance, and wellbeing offerings. Paid holidays, vacation, sick time, and other time-off policies apply as described in Cisco’s policies.

Sign up to receive notifications of similar jobs #J-18808-Ljbffr